My Favorite Store! 5/30/2011

If I could have one fantasy come true, it would be that I could go to Trader Joe's one day and purchase everything I could possibly want (and many of each my favorites) without having to worry about how much money I was spending. This does not imply that Trader Joe's is expensive, that s far from the truth. It just suggests the state of my own finances. Here is an example of great prices: One day I was in there when they were sampling Boursin cheese. This typically comes in a small package. Trader Joe's was asking $3.00 and some change for it. The same day I saw the exact same cheese at Giant Eagle for $7.00 and some change. I have never found an item there that was not quality and that I did not like. I love this store. The help is always friendly and courteous. I love that it is a small store, but make a point to avoid it on weekends because it can get crowded. I never have trouble with over crowding on week days. Whole Foods is for yuppies. Trader Joe's is for real people. more
